<div class="mceTemp mceIEcenter">Congratulations to Andrew Goudelock! Drew proved that he is definitely one of the country&#8217;s top 3-point shooters Thursday at Hofheinz Pavillion, winning the Men&#8217;s 3-Point Shooting Championship and then capturing a shootout against the women&#8217;s champion. Drew, a 6-2 senior, scored 21 points to beat Chris Warren of Mississippi for the title, then won a 16-15 squeaker over women&#8217;s champion Cerie Mosgrove of Massachusetts as a bonus. Drew was high scorer in all three rounds hitting all five shots from the final rack to beat Warren. (from the Post and Courier)</div>

<h3 style="TEXT-ALIGN: left"> The Sky Is So Alive</h3>
<p style="TEXT-ALIGN: left">                         By Pamela S Welter</p>
<p>Look Up . . . to the sun - for warmth and light.</p>
<p>Look Up . . .to the moon &amp; stars - for wishes and dreams.</p>
<p>Look Up . . . to crystal blue firmament - for clarity and vision.</p>
<p>Look Up . . . to wispy, floating clouds - for imagination.</p>
<p>Look Up . . . to lightning flashes - for inspiration.</p>
<p>Look Up . . . to light rays and rainbows - for hope and promise.</p>
<p>Look Up . . . to heavenly faces - with gratitude for guidance and protection.</p>
<p>A world awaits. Look Up!</p>

<p>CARY, N.C.     <br />
The No. 1 Virginia men’s tennis team won its third consecutive ACC Tournament title and its fifth in the past six years by downing No. 20 Wake Forest 4-0 in Sunday’s final at the Cary Tennis Park. The Cavaliers won all three of its matches in the tournament by a 4-0 score, becoming the first team in ACC Tournament history to accomplish the feat.</p>
<p>“I am really proud of this championship,” said <strong>Virginia head coach Brian Boland</strong>. “We lost three of the best players in the country last year in Somdev Devvarman, Treat Huey and Teddy Angelinos. It says a lot about the young men on this team that they were able to step up this season. We have won five of the last six ACC Tournaments, but this one is really special.”</p>
<p>“The team is playing with a lot of <a title="The Confidence Factor" href="http://www.lindaleclaire.com/products"><strong>confidence</strong></a> right now,”<strong> said Boland.</strong> “We have played a tough schedule and they have overcome some adversity.”</p>
<p>The Cavaliers receive the ACC’s automatic bid to the NCAA Tournament by winning the title. The field of 64 will be announced on April 28.</p>
